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

EL7

Costs and Efficiency:

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.

Lexus UX is significantly cheaper – starting at 38,700 £ , while the NIO EL7 costs 63,300 £ . That’s a price difference of around 24,600 £.

UX

Engine and Performance:

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.

When it comes to engine power, the NIO EL7 offers significantly more power – delivering 653 HP compared to 199 HP. That’s roughly 454 HP more horsepower.

When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the NIO EL7 is clearly quicker – completing the sprint in 3.9 s, while the Lexus UX takes 7.9 s. That’s about 4 s quicker.

EL7

Space and Everyday Use:

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.

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.

In terms of curb weight, Lexus UX is clearly lighter – 1,495 kg compared to 2,421 kg. The difference is around 926 kg.

Looking at boot space, the NIO EL7 offers considerably more boot space – 570 L compared to 320 L. That’s a difference of about 250 L.

When it comes to payload, the Lexus UX carries visibly more – 615 kg compared to 469 kg. That’s a difference of about 146 kg.

NIO EL7

The NIO EL7 arrives as a roomy electric SUV that pairs restrained elegance with bold design cues, and its interior feels like a calm, tech-forward lounge rather than a gadget parade. For buyers who crave effortless cruising, spirited performance and a tastefully premium experience — with just the right amount of showmanship for the driveway — the EL7 is an enticing, slightly theatrical choice.

details

Lexus UX

The Lexus UX is a compact luxury crossover that blends sharp styling with a quiet, comfortable cabin, perfect for urban buyers who want premium feel without shouting about it. It rides with poise, serves up plush materials and thoughtful tech, and—while it won’t satisfy anyone chasing track thrills—it's a smart, stylish choice for everyday driving.
